All the Old Testament prophets pointed to someone outside of themselves, but Jesus points to Himself, and He says, “I am the one the Old Testament speaks of in your midst.” John devoted a third of his Gospel to the last 20 hours of Jesus’ life before the crucifixion. In the last two chapters of John, politicians are grasping for power and priests are worried about their theology while the Truth is standing in their midst. The resurrection is the ultimate proof of Jesus’ truth claims.
